Ametrine Benefits
Elegant and unique, ametrine gemstone is said to have metaphysical properties of two gemstones– Amethyst and Citrine. The term ‘Ametrine’ is itself created by merging the two terms AMET hyst and cit RINE . This beautiful bi-color quartz is often marketed as ‘Bolivianite’ and ‘Trystine’ and is worn to gain its healing benefits.

Ametrine Prices
Ametrine is a rare yet highly affordable gemstone which is primarily worn for its astrological and healing benefits. Ametrine stone price is majorly determined by its origin, color, clarity, cut and carat weight. Ametrine stone price in India starts from ₹ 150 per carat ($3 approx.) and can reach up to ₹ 1,000 per carat ($15 approx.) and above. Prices in other countries like Dubai, the UK, the USA, and the UAE may vary depending upon the demand/supply cycle.
-
Origin
– Being the most sought-after variety, Anahi ametrine value remains highest in comparison to stones from other origins. Because of low transparency and paler hue, the The price of ametrine crystal from India and Brazil is much lower than that of Anahi ametrine. -
Color
– Color is the most influential factor that adds maximum points to the value. Stones with distinctly visible, deep, and bright color bands of orange and purple fetch a good premium. Ametrine gemstone price is reduced for stones with pale or indistinctly visible color bands.
Color variation in Ametrine – Low to High -
Clarity
– Since ametrines are usually found in good clarity, there is very little chance to buy ametrine that is not eye-clean. A highly transparent ametrine with minimum eye-visible inclusions always fetch a good amount. The price of ametrine per carat decreases significantly for highly included gems with poor transparency. -
Cut
– Cutting a gemstone can increase its cost by up to 20% because of the waste involved in the process. A heavily faceted ametrine value is always higher than that of round and oval ametrines. Stones in fancy cuts such as Asscher cut, cushion cut, etc. need extra care and good lapidary (gem-cutting) skills, therefore, are often priced exorbitantly. -
Carat weight
– Ametrine gemstones can be found in all shapes and sizes. However, large size stones are always much more valuable than smaller ones as color bands look prominent in bigger ones. The price of ametrine per carat increases with size but not as drastically as in expensive gemstones. -
Ametrine stone prices in India are calculated both in Carats as well as Ratti. Since a carat is a bigger unit, the Ametrine price per carat appears slightly higher than Ametrine price per ratti.
1 Ratti = 0.91 Carats
Ametrine Quality
The quality of Ametrine gemstone is characterized by multiple factors including its origin, distinct dual color (orange and purple), clarity, and cut. From an astrological perspective, a natural, highly transparent, bright-colored stone with clearly visible color bands, is considered the best quality Ametrine gemstone.

Origin – Ametrine crystals are resourced from the quartz mines of eastern Bolivia (Santa Cruz), some parts of Brazil, Uruguay, and India. Anahi mine in Bolivia is the oldest and also the finest resource for the best quality ametrine natural gems, which are called Anahi ametrines. Brazilian ametrine is the next most preferred choice after Bolivian ametrine.
Color – The color of ametrine crystal majorly determines its quality. It usually contains two distinct bands of orange and purple color. Deep, rich-colored ametrine stones displaying equal ratios of orange and purple are rare and extremely valuable. Pale colored ametrine with poorly distinguishable color bands of inferior quality.
Clarity – Like other quartz varieties, Ametrine is also a Type II gemstone which usually contains inclusions. These inclusions such as tiger strips, liquid inclusions, internal fractures and hematite needle-like inclusions often disturb the color quality of the stone. However, eye-clean ametrines can also be found yet their occurrence is uncommon. Needless to mention that the finest quality ametrines are always highly transparent and come with minimum eye visible inclusions.
Cut – A skillfully faceted ametrine gemstone always appears brighter, lustrous and highly transparent. Low-quality ametrine stones are generally shaped in cabochons (dome-shaped, polished stone with no facets) to retain their color and weight. And the most popular and desirable are rectangular-cut or emerald-cut ametrines, with a 50/50 ratio of orange and purple color bands, and are always in high demand. There are three main types of shapes of Ametrine which are as follows Pear shape Ametrine, Rectangular Octagonal Ametrine and Cushion cut Ametrine .

Ametrine stones are also quite popular in the jewelry segment. However due to their limited availability, ametrines are usually produced artificially by irradiating the quartz mineral at differential temperatures. These synthetic or lab-created ametrine loose gemstones are available at cheap prices but are not considered good for astrological purposes.
